Effect of Desliming on Flotation Response of Kansanshi Mixed Copper Ore

Conclusions. The outcome of this work has shown that desliming improves the flotation response of the Kansanshi mixed copper ore. Coarse chalcopyrite recovery in a universal froth flotation machine

A new froth flotation machine has been developed, known as the NovaCell, which can recover mineral particles over a wide particle size range, from the lower limit of flotation, to an upper limit which depends on the liberation characteristics of the ore.
